Ba₄VP is an intermetallic compound containing barium, vanadium, and phosphorus, representing a research-phase material in the family of multimetallic phosphides. This compound is primarily of academic and exploratory interest rather than an established industrial material, with potential applications in advanced functional materials where specific crystal structures or electronic properties derived from transition metal–main group combinations could be leveraged.
